BWW Review: George Orwell Meets Brecht and Weill In the Musical CABARET DOS BICHOS

With libreto, lyrics and direction by Ze Henrique de Paula and original music and musical direction by Fernanda Maia, the language used is inspired by German cabarets, strongly referenced in Bertolt Brecht and Kurt Weil. George Orwell's Animal Farm takes place on a farm led initially by Mr. Jones. However, dissatisfied with the domination, the animals decide to make a revolution. They organize and expel Mr. Jones from the farm, as they no longer accept being treated as human slaves. Pigs now lead the farm, considering themselves the most intelligent animals. One of the century's greatest writers, Orwell paints a stark portrayal of power's relationship to the individual and society and its processes.

Andrew Polec Wins The International Lotte Lenya Competition – Theatrical/Voice

Andrew Polec, 32, actor/singer/musician/composer from Doylestown, PA, is honored to have been named the first prize winner in The Kurt Weill Foundation for Music 's 23rd Annual Lotte Lenya Competition, which took place in New York City on August 28, 2021. He received the $20,000 First Prize plus a $2,000 Finalist Prize, for a total of $22,000. Each of his four selections were a fully realized one-act drama. 

VIDEO: The Kurt Weill Foundation Tributes Rebecca Luker

In honor of Luker, a six-time judge for the competition, the Lotte Lenya Competition has created the Rebecca Luker Award, given for an outstanding performance of a selection from a Golden Age musical. The first Luker award was given to Taylor-Alexis DuPont for her performance of “Supper Time,” from As Thousands Cheer.

DER SILBERSEE Will Be Performed at Opera Ballet Vlaanderen Next Month

'Silverlake will bear whoever must go farther!' (Wer weiter muss, den trägt der Silbersee): this is the final, utopian sentence at the end of Der Silbersee by Kurt Weill and Georg Kaiser. - Severin and Olim, the two protagonists of this grim fairy tale, flee from the winter of a cynical and violent society to the spring of a new life across a magical frozen lake.
